Output 9532079ac837eb0956ad13a828912537a939c9fbaeef2491b7ad7878085d3c42:0

value
1306690945
script pubkey
OP_0 OP_PUSHBYTES_20 8600c13f8e90a243193c78c425291a9fdd207220
address
tb1qscqvz0uwjz3yxxfu0rzz22g6nlwjqu3q49h0ym
transaction
9532079ac837eb0956ad13a828912537a939c9fbaeef2491b7ad7878085d3c42
confirmations
108190
spent
true